Steady-state current–voltage relation,ISS versus V, for the model, showing the effects of blocking either or both of the two K+ currents of the model. A, Large “bump” in ISS in the voltage range of −60 to −40 mV is caused by the (outward) window current ofIA. The modest “trough” inISS at approximately −70 mV is caused by the (inward) window current of IT at steady state. This N-shaped region of ISS is seen better in the magnification in B. B, Part of A is magnified.
